Bird's Eye View of a Day

Rate this book
Five friends, each coming from a different background, get together to enjoy for the day. Jane and Sarah are classmates, Richi is a college dropout and has no faith in authority of any form, Adam likes Physics, drugs and poetry and Mark studies MBA and wants to be an entrepreneur someday. Events take them to an underground club in the suburbs, where they are unwittingly drawn into a vicious circle. Very powerful people are after the lives of the five friends. Can they save themselves? One thing is sure, this one day in their lives will leave a permanent scar in them.

Subhajit Ganguly is the Executive Director of Lawrence Anthony Earth Organization, India (Kolkata) and works for restoring the balance in the natural environment. He is a physicist whose areas of expertise include the Theory of Abstraction. His contribution to the theory is noteworthy, to say the least. The other areas of science, that he has made notable contributions to include astronomy, mathematics and the Chaos Theory. Zero-postulation is a new concept he has introduced to the theorizing process in sciences. He has also made noteworthy contribution towards deciphering the Indus Valley Civilization script. He has been an active member of various Open Science Movements for quite some time now and advocates Open Access and Open Data. Subhajit is the Ambassador for the Open Knowledge Foundation (OKFN), India. The Open Education and Open Data projects, Initiated by Subhajit, has attained considerable success within a short span. He also wears the hat of being a public speaker too from time to time. Besides being an acclaimed author of nonfiction, he has numerous works of fiction to his credit.
